Saab 93 key fob battery

It's probably time to replace the battery in your key fob in case you've noticed an inability to respond. While there could be a variety of reasons behind the delay the dead battery is most likely to be the culprit. It's a quick and simple fix, so don't delay.

The first step is to remove the backup key from the fob. To do this, push hard on the saab 9-3 key Programming Logo and pull on the key loop. Insert a flathead screwdriver through the indentation in the key fob case. Turn the screwdriver around to separate the case. The plastic should not be damaged if you don't apply excessive force.

Once the case has been opened you will be able to see the electronic components inside. The circuit board is attached to the metal clips. If they are rusty or dirty the fob won't perform as it should. You can clean them using rubbing alcohol. This is only a temporary solution. The clips will eventually wear out and need to be replaced.

Before you replace the battery, you need to test the door locks on your car using your backup remote. If your backup remote works then the issue is likely to be with your main key fob. If the issue persists even after replacing the battery, there might be an issue with your vehicle.

Saab 93 key fob case

A replacement key for saab 93 case can be bought in the event that your key fob is tired. These are available on the internet and easily installed to the remote control you already have. The only thing you need is a flathead screwdriver as well as some patience. Insert the flathead screwdriver into the slot at the middle of the case, and then gently split it open. Be careful not to damage the limiters which hold the battery. After removing the emergency key and badge, the new case is able to be inserted into existing electronics. No reprogramming is needed.
